Transaction 3f87848fb5996c763d7e2cdea7301e5debc4a5e5b9baa131da323d936fe12319

2 Input
2 Outputs
  • 3f87848fb5996c763d7e2cdea7301e5debc4a5e5b9baa131da323d936fe12319:0
  • value  409080
    address  1NTGzNASTv5k1sfcanqZzQnqKWMRoFEfTB
  • 3f87848fb5996c763d7e2cdea7301e5debc4a5e5b9baa131da323d936fe12319:1
  • value  20335903
    address  1M74wcgSPteV5ewWeccjFX52rX781kAiWv